    Manchester-based property company Bruntwood has announced a new boutique gym and personal training facility at its Riverside complex, situated on New Bailey Street, on the banks of the River Irwell.

    FORM, the brainchild of personal trainers Libby Smith and Ben Wood – who together have more than 20 years’ experience in the fitness industry – will boast a fully-equipped 2,200 sq ft gym, in addition to an outdoor astroturf training area.

    At its new city centre location FORM will offer various personalised programmes as well as 1-2-1 and group personal training. Clients will also have access to online coaching via a private members’ section on the website.

    The pair have also commissioned Didsbury-based healthy eatery Bosu Body Bar, to provide a range of freshly-prepared, high-protein meals for clients.

    Libby and Ben had been searching for a suitable city-centre venue to launch their all-inclusive personal training concept for a number of years, but had struggled to find somewhere flexible enough to accommodate their specific fit-out requirements.

    Along with 1.5 acres of public realm the campus features a secure bicycle storage area and shower facilities to encourage workers to walk, run or cycle to work.

    Pete Crowther, managing director at Bruntwood, added: “The research is clear; active workers are happier, healthier and more productive. Employee wellbeing is, therefore, at the forefront of our minds when designing and fitting out all of our developments. We want to ensure everyone on our sites has the opportunity to commute by foot or by bicycle.

    “The Riverside complex already offers great outdoor space for exercise, but we have been looking to bring in a suitable dedicated gym facility to complement the other amenities on site for some time now.

    “FORM is a perfect fit for us and we’re delighted to welcome them to the site. They have a great concept and, with a ready client base of busy professionals working at Riverside, I’m confident their business will go from strength to strength.”

    FORM will join current Riverside customers, which include AO.com, MoneyPlus Group and Futureworks. Everyone working at the site will benefit from subsidised access to the fitness facility.
